在如今数据驱动的商业环境中,企业面临的一个关键挑战是如何有效地集成各类商业智能(BI)工具,以打通多数据源,实现真正的数据互通和洞察力提升。随着数据量的爆炸式增长和数据源的多样化,企业需要的不仅仅是单点的数据分析工具,而是能将分散的数据整合为一体的解决方案。FineBI作为一款新一代自助大数据分析的商业智能工具,正是为了帮助企业解决这一难题而生。本文将深入探讨商业BI工具的集成能力以及如何打通多数据源的解决方案。

🌐 一、商业BI工具的集成能力
商业BI工具的集成能力涉及多个方面,从数据源的连接、数据的清洗与转换,到最终的数据可视化和分析。一个高效的BI工具需要具备强大的集成能力,以支持企业从多个数据源中提取、整合和分析数据。
1. 数据源连接的多样性
现代企业的数据源非常多样化,包括内部数据库、外部API、社交媒体数据、物联网设备数据等。BI工具需要具备灵活的连接能力,以适应不同类型的数据源。
- 数据库连接:支持主流的关系型数据库(如MySQL、PostgreSQL)、NoSQL数据库(如MongoDB)等。
- API集成:能够通过API接口获取实时数据,尤其是在处理动态数据时。
- 文件导入:支持Excel、CSV等常见文件格式的数据导入。
数据源类型 | 示例 | 集成方式 |
---|---|---|
数据库 | MySQL, PostgreSQL | 直接连接 |
文件 | Excel, CSV | 文件上传 |
API | RESTful API | API调用 |
2. 数据清洗与转换
在数据集成过程中,数据清洗与转换是必不可少的步骤。不同数据源的数据格式和结构可能存在巨大差异,BI工具需要提供灵活的数据清洗与转换功能,以确保最终数据的一致性和准确性。
- 数据清洗:处理数据中的缺失值、异常值以及重复数据。
- 数据转换:将不同格式的数据转换为统一格式,以便后续分析。
- 数据合并:对来自不同数据源的数据进行合并,生成综合数据集。
3. 数据可视化与分析
集成后的数据需要通过可视化工具进行展示,以便于用户直观地理解数据背后的信息。BI工具的可视化能力决定了数据洞察的深度和广度。
- 图表类型多样化:支持折线图、柱状图、饼图、热力图等多种图表类型。
- 动态交互:支持用户在图表上进行交互操作,如筛选、放大等。
- 自动化报告:通过自动化功能生成定期报告,节省人工操作时间。
4. 多人协作与分享
BI工具不仅要支持单人使用,还应具备多人协作的能力,以便团队共同分析和分享数据洞察。
- 权限管理:为不同用户分配不同的访问权限,确保数据安全。
- 实时协作:支持多人同时查看和编辑数据分析结果。
- 分享与发布:能够将分析结果分享给特定用户或发布到公司内部平台。
🔗 二、打通多数据源的解决方案
在企业级应用中,数据通常分散在不同的系统和平台中。要打通这些多数据源,实现数据的无缝整合,需要制定全面的解决方案。
1. 确定数据集成需求
首先,企业需要明确其数据集成的需求和目标。不同的业务场景可能对数据有不同的要求,因此需要根据具体需求制定相应的解决方案。
- 业务目标:明确数据集成的最终目标,如提升销售效率、优化供应链管理等。
- 数据类型:明确需要集成的数据类型,包括结构化数据和非结构化数据。
- 时间框架:确定数据集成的时间框架,是实时数据还是批处理数据。
2. 选择合适的集成工具
选择合适的集成工具是实现多数据源打通的关键。企业可以根据自身需求选择不同类型的工具,如ETL工具、数据中台等。
- ETL工具:用于数据的抽取、转换和加载,适合批处理数据。
- 数据中台:提供数据的集中管理和服务化能力,支持实时数据处理。
- 云服务:利用云服务平台(如AWS、Azure)提供的数据集成解决方案。
工具类型 | 功能 | 适用场景 |
---|---|---|
ETL工具 | 数据抽取、转换、加载 | 批处理数据 |
数据中台 | 数据管理、服务化 | 实时数据 |
云服务 | 集成解决方案 | 弹性需求 |
3. 数据集成流程设计
设计合理的数据集成流程是确保数据顺利流动的基础。流程设计需要考虑数据源的特性、数据流的路径以及可能的异常情况。
- 数据流路径:明确数据从源头到目标的流动路径,确保数据的完整性。
- 数据转换规则:定义数据转换的规则和标准,以确保数据的一致性。
- 异常处理机制:设计异常处理机制,确保在数据集成过程中出现问题时能够及时修复。
4. 实施与监控
在制定好数据集成方案后,需要进行实施和监控,以确保数据集成的效果符合预期。
- 实施计划:制定详细的实施计划,明确每个阶段的任务和责任。
- 实时监控:通过监控工具实时跟踪数据集成的状态,及时发现和解决问题。
- 效果评估:定期评估数据集成的效果,根据评估结果进行优化。
📈 三、FineBI的集成能力与应用
FineBI作为国内市场占有率第一的商业智能工具,以其强大的集成能力和灵活性赢得了广泛的认可。其在数据源连接、数据处理和可视化分析方面的优势使其成为企业数据集成的理想选择。
1. 灵活的数据源连接
FineBI支持多种数据源的连接,包括主流的数据库、API接口和文件导入,为企业提供了灵活的数据接入方式。
- 数据库支持:FineBI能够无缝连接MySQL、Oracle、SQL Server等主流数据库。
- API集成:通过FineBI的API接口,企业可以轻松实现与第三方系统的数据对接。
- 多种文件格式:支持Excel、CSV等常见文件格式的数据导入,方便用户进行数据分析。
2. 强大的数据处理能力
FineBI提供了丰富的数据处理工具,包括数据清洗、转换和合并,帮助用户高效地处理来自不同数据源的数据。
- 数据清洗工具:提供便捷的数据清洗工具,帮助用户快速处理缺失值和异常值。
- 数据转换功能:支持多种数据转换操作,使用户能够轻松实现数据格式的转换。
- 数据合并功能:通过FineBI,用户可以将来自不同数据源的数据合并为一个综合数据集,为后续分析提供便利。
3. 优秀的数据可视化功能
FineBI的可视化功能强大,支持多种图表类型和动态交互,帮助用户深入挖掘数据价值。
- 多样化图表:支持折线图、柱状图、饼图等多种图表类型,满足用户的不同展示需求。
- 动态交互:FineBI支持用户在图表上进行交互操作,如筛选、放大等,提升用户体验。
- 自动化报告:通过FineBI,用户可以轻松生成自动化报告,定期分享数据分析结果。
4. 支持多人协作与分享
FineBI不仅支持单人使用,还具备多人协作能力,适合团队共同分析和分享数据洞察。
- 权限管理:FineBI提供灵活的权限管理功能,确保数据安全。
- 实时协作:支持多人同时查看和编辑分析结果,提升团队协作效率。
- 分享与发布:用户可以将分析结果分享给特定用户或发布到公司内部平台,方便数据的传播与应用。
📚 结论
商业BI工具的集成能力对于企业的数据管理和分析至关重要。通过对数据源连接、数据清洗与转换、数据可视化以及多人协作的深入分析,企业可以选择合适的BI工具并制定相应的解决方案,实现多数据源的有效集成。FineBI作为一款市场领先的BI工具,以其强大的集成能力和灵活性为企业提供了全面的数据分析支持。希望本文的探讨能够为您在数据集成方面的实践提供有益的参考。
参考文献
- 《大数据导论》,李飞著,北京大学出版社,2019年。
- 《商业智能:从数据到决策》,张浩著,清华大学出版社,2021年。
- 《企业数据化转型》,王强著,电子工业出版社,2020年。
本文相关FAQs
🤔 如何评估商业BI工具的集成能力?
小团队正在考虑引入商业BI工具以提升数据分析能力,但市场上工具众多,功能各异。老板希望能选择一个集成能力强的BI工具,以便能与现有的多种数据源无缝对接。有没有人能分享一下评估BI工具集成能力的关键点?尤其是对于多数据源整合方面的考虑?
评估商业BI工具的集成能力是一个复杂但重要的任务,特别是在企业需要整合多个数据源的情况下。BI工具的集成能力直接关系到其效率和使用体验。以下是一些关键的评估点:
首先,你需要关注BI工具支持的数据源种类。一个强大的BI工具应该能够支持多种数据库类型,包括SQL和NoSQL数据库、云数据仓库、大数据平台、以及多种文件格式如Excel、CSV等。比如,FineBI就是一个典型的例子,它支持与主流数据库和多种数据格式的连接。
其次,检查工具的数据连接方式。许多现代BI工具采用了ODBC、JDBC等标准化的连接方式,确保数据源的广泛兼容性。同时,也要评估工具的自动化数据刷新能力,以确保数据的实时性和准确性。
另外,安全性和权限管理也是必须考虑的。BI工具需要具备强大的安全策略,包括数据传输加密、用户权限管理等,以确保数据在传输和分析过程中的安全。
最后,集成的灵活性和可扩展性也很重要。企业的数据需求可能会随时间变化,因此BI工具应具有较强的可扩展性以应对未来的数据增长和新的集成需求。
BI工具的集成能力不仅仅是技术上的考量,更是企业战略的一部分。选择一个能够与企业现有系统无缝对接的BI工具,可以极大提升企业的数据分析效率,从而帮助企业更好地应对市场变化和竞争挑战。
🔗 如何实现多个数据源的无缝整合?
公司正在经历数据来源多样化的挑战,数据分布在不同的数据库和云平台中,且格式各异。IT部门头疼于如何实现这些数据源的无缝整合,以便于统一分析和决策支持。有没有成功整合多个数据源的经验可以分享?
实现多数据源的无缝整合是现代企业面临的常见挑战,尤其是在数据来源多样、分布在不同平台和格式情况下。以下是一些实现多数据源整合的经验和建议:

一、选择合适的工具和技术: FineBI等现代BI工具提供了强大的多数据源整合功能。它支持跨多个数据库的连接和数据整合,能够自动识别数据类型并进行转换。此外,FineBI的拖拽式界面使得用户无需编写复杂代码即可实现数据整合。
二、数据清洗和转换: 在整合之前,需要进行数据清洗和转换,以确保数据的一致性和准确性。使用ETL(Extract, Transform, Load)工具可以帮助完成这项工作。ETL工具能够自动化地提取、转换并加载数据,确保数据在整合过程中不丢失精度。
三、建立数据仓库或数据湖: 数据仓库或者数据湖是整合多数据源的理想解决方案。数据仓库适合结构化数据的分析,而数据湖则更适合处理各种格式的数据。通过使用这些技术,企业可以实现数据的集中存储和管理,便于后续分析和应用。
四、实时数据同步: 为了确保数据分析的准确性,实时数据同步是必不可少的。通过设置定时任务或者使用实时数据流技术,可以实现数据的自动刷新和同步。
五、安全性和权限管理: 在整合过程中,确保数据安全以及合理的用户权限管理是必要的。FineBI等工具提供了完善的安全策略,可以在数据整合过程中对用户权限进行精细化管理,确保数据安全。
成功实现多数据源整合不仅可以提升数据分析的准确性和效率,还能为企业提供更全面的决策支持。
🚀 如何优化商业BI工具在多数据源环境下的性能?
已经为企业搭建了一个基于FineBI的BI平台,但在整合多数据源时,遇到性能瓶颈,尤其在大数据量查询和实时分析时。有没有人能提供一些优化BI工具性能的建议或经验?
在多数据源环境下,优化BI工具的性能是确保数据分析高效、准确的关键步骤。以下是一些针对FineBI平台的优化建议:
一、优化数据库查询: 对于大数据量查询,优化数据库的SQL查询是提高性能的有效方法。使用索引、视图以及分区表可以显著降低查询时间。此外,FineBI的智能查询优化功能可以自动选择最佳查询路径,从而提升性能。
二、数据缓存和预计算: FineBI提供了数据缓存和预计算功能,可以将常用的查询结果缓存到内存中,从而加快数据访问速度。对于复杂的计算,可以在数据导入时预先计算,从而减少实时计算的负担。
三、分布式计算和存储: 在大数据环境下,采用分布式计算和存储技术可以显著提升系统性能。FineBI支持与Hadoop、Spark等大数据平台的集成,能够利用分布式架构的优势,实现高效的数据处理。
四、硬件和网络优化: 硬件和网络环境对BI工具的性能也有很大影响。确保服务器配置合理,网络带宽充足,可以减少数据传输的延迟,提高整体性能。
五、用户权限和数据隔离: 通过合理设置用户权限和数据隔离,可以减少不必要的数据访问,从而提高系统性能。FineBI提供了灵活的权限管理功能,可以根据用户角色和需求进行权限设置。

六、定期系统维护和升级: 定期对BI系统进行维护和升级,保持系统在最佳状态。FineBI团队定期发布更新版本,修复已知问题并提升性能。
通过这些措施,可以有效提升FineBI在多数据源环境下的性能,为企业提供更快速、更可靠的数据分析服务。
更多关于FineBI的信息可以通过 FineBI在线试用 进行了解。